DANVILLE, Wash. — Fire officials said the Goosmus Fire burning near the United States and Canada border in Ferry County is now 100% contained.
The fire has been burning since September 25 and has burned over 1,700 acres.
Big Goosmus Road and Fourth of July Road are still closed to the public. Access is available for local residents only.
Smoke will still be visible for at least several weeks inside the fire perimeter, but the fire is not likely to spread past the containment line.
Incident Management said the fire was initially caused by a powerline.
